Welcome to Pensacola Beach

Welcome to Pensacola Beach, where sugar-white sands meet emerald-green waters, creating a paradise for residents and visitors alike. Shining on the stunning Gulf Coast of Florida on a barrier island, Pensacola Beach offers a unique blend of natural beauty, outdoor recreation, and coastal charm.
 
Santa Rosa Island stands as a pristine gem along Florida's Gulf Coast. Spanning approximately 40 miles in length, this barrier island offers a haven for beach lovers, nature enthusiasts, and outdoor adventurers alike. Attractions and Events

Beyond the beach, Pensacola Beach is home to a variety of attractions and events that showcase the area's rich history and culture. Visit the historic Fort Pickens, explore the Gulf Islands National Seashore, or take a dolphin cruise to see the local marine life up close. Throughout the year, Pensacola Beach hosts a calendar of events, including festivals, concerts, and fireworks displays, providing endless opportunities for fun and excitement.
 
Situated along two major migratory fly zones, Pensacola's Gulf Islands National Seashore offers a haven for tens of thousands of birds seeking rest and sustenance. From colorful songbirds to majestic birds of prey, our diverse ecosystem supports over 300 species year-round. Explore our miles of undeveloped coastline, oak hammocks, and dune vegetation, where you'll encounter a feathery spectacle at every turn. Whether you're a seasoned birder or a novice enthusiast, Pensacola Bay Area's bays, bayous, beaches, rivers, and woodlands provide ideal birding spots for every nature lover.

Overview for Pensacola Beach, FL

4,876 people live in Pensacola Beach, where the median age is 52 and the average individual income is $67,068. Data provided by the U.S. Census Bureau.
